          Central sensitivity syndromes: a new paradigm and group nosology for fibromyalgia and overlapping conditions, and the related issue of disease versus illness.

          S. Yunus (2008)
          To discuss the current terminologies used for fibromyalgia syndrome (FMS) and related overlapping conditions, to examine if central sensitivity syndromes (CSS) is the appropriate nosology for these disorders, and to explore the issue of disease versus illness. A literature search was performed through PubMed, Web of Science, and ScienceDirect using a number of keywords, eg, functional somatic syndromes, somatoform disorders, medically unexplained symptoms, organic and nonorganic, and diseases and illness. Relevant articles were then reviewed and representative ones cited. Terminologies currently used for CSS conditions predominantly represent a psychosocial construct and are inappropriate. On the other hand, CSS seems to be the logical nosology based on a biopsychosocial model. Such terms as "medically unexplained symptoms," "somatization," "somatization disorder," and "functional somatic syndromes" in the context of CSS should be abandoned. Given current scientific knowledge, the concept of disease-illness dualism has no rational basis and impedes proper patient-physician communication, resulting in poor patient care. The concept of CSS is likely to promote research, education, and proper patient management. CSS seems to be a useful paradigm and an appropriate terminology for FMS and related conditions. The disease-illness, as well as organic/non-organic dichotomy, should be rejected.

            The prevalence and burden of arthritis.

            The prevalence of arthritis is high, with osteoarthritis (OA) being one of the most frequent disorders in the population. In England and Wales, between 1.3 and 1.75 million people have OA and a further 0.25-0.5 million have rheumatoid arthritis (RA), while in France some 6 million new diagnoses of OA are made each year. In 1997, approximately 16% of the US population had some form of arthritis. This prevalence is expected to increase in the coming years, as arthritis more often affects the elderly, a proportion of the population that is increasing. The economic burden of such musculoskeletal diseases is also high, accounting for up to 1-2.5% of the gross national product of western nations. This burden comprises both the direct costs of medical interventions and indirect costs, such as premature mortality and chronic and short-term disability. The impact of arthritis on quality of life is of particular importance. Musculoskeletal disorders are associated with some of the poorest quality-of-life issues, particularly in terms of bodily pain (mean score from the MOS 36-item Short Form Health Survey of 52.1) and physical functioning (49.9), where quality of life is lower than that for gastrointestinal conditions (bodily pain 52.9, physical functioning 55.4), chronic respiratory diseases (72.7, 65.4) and cardiovascular conditions (64.7, 59.3).

              Effect of improving depression care on pain and functional outcomes among older adults with arthritis: a randomized controlled trial.

              Depression and arthritis are disabling and common health problems in late life. Depression is also a risk factor for poor health outcomes among arthritis patients. To determine whether enhancing care for depression improves pain and functional outcomes in older adults with depression and arthritis. Preplanned subgroup analyses of Improving Mood-Promoting Access to Collaborative Treatment (IMPACT), a randomized controlled trial of 1801 depressed older adults (> or =60 years), which was performed at 18 primary care clinics from 8 health care organizations in 5 states across the United States from July 1999 to August 2001. A total of 1001 (56%) reported coexisting arthritis at baseline. Antidepressant medications and/or 6 to 8 sessions of psychotherapy (Problem-Solving Treatment in Primary Care). Depression, pain intensity (scale of 0 to 10), interference with daily activities due to arthritis (scale of 0 to 10), general health status, and overall quality-of-life outcomes assessed at baseline, 3, 6, and 12 months. In addition to reduction in depressive symptoms, the intervention group compared with the usual care group at 12 months had lower mean (SE) scores for pain intensity (5.62 [0.16] vs 6.15 [0.16]; between-group difference, -0.53; 95% confidence interval [CI], -0.92 to -0.14; P =.009), interference with daily activities due to arthritis (4.40 [0.18] vs 4.99 [0.17]; between-group difference, -0.59; 95% CI, -1.00 to -0.19; P =.004), and interference with daily activities due to pain (2.92 [0.07] vs 3.17 [0.07]; between-group difference, -0.26; 95% CI, -0.41 to -0.10; P =.002). Overall health and quality of life were also enhanced among intervention patients relative to control patients at 12 months. In a large and diverse population of older adults with arthritis (mostly osteoarthritis) and comorbid depression, benefits of improved depression care extended beyond reduced depressive symptoms and included decreased pain as well as improved functional status and quality of life.
